Clause 2 provides for the commencement of the proposed Act on a day or
days to be appointed by proclamation.
Clause 3 defines certain words and expressions used in the proposed Act.
Clause 4 deals with the transfer of the assets, rights and liabilities of the
Administrator of the South-west Tablelands Water Supply on the dissolution
of the statutory corporation. The clause also gives effect to proposed
Schedule 1 that applies to the transfer of assets, rights and liabilities under
the clause.
Clause 5 is a formal provision giving effect to proposed Schedule 2 that
deals with the transfer of staff attached to the South-west Tablelands Water
Supply to Goldenfields Water County Council with effect from the
commencement of the proposed Schedule.
Clause 6 repeals the South-west Tablelands Water Supply Act 1924, the
South-west Tablelands Water Supply Administration Act 1941 and the
South-west Tablelands Water Supply Administration (Price of Water)
Regulation 1994.
Clause 7 is a formal provision giving effect to the provisions of a savings or
transitional nature set out in proposed Schedule 3.
Clause 8 makes a consequential amendment to the Capital Debt Charges
Act 1957 to remove references to the Administrator of the South-west
Tablelands Water Supply and the South-west Tablelands Water Supply
Administration Act 1941 from the Schedule to that Act.
Schedule 1 sets out the provisions that are to apply to the transfer of assets,
rights and liabilities under the proposed Act.
Schedule 2 sets out the provisions that are to apply to the transfer of staff
under the proposed Act.
Schedule 3 sets out provisions of a savings or transitional nature consequent
on the enactment of the proposed Act.
